Here is another solution. I'm thinking that SR and SFCHT1 should only be matched between [ and ]:

Code:
sed -e '/[[][^]]*SFCHT1[]-]/s/poweredOn/poweredOn|T1/' \
    -e '/[[][^]]*SR[]-]/s/poweredOn/poweredOn|DR/' file.csv


Example:

Code:
$ file.csv
Server1|poweredOn|268401|[Z0109-GEN-SFCHT1-VMS-R001SR] Server1/Server1.vmx|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5 (64-bit)
Server2|poweredOn|268401|[Z0110-DSP-SFCHT1-VMS-R001SM] Not SR/Server1.vmx|Red Hat Enterprise Linux 3.2 (32-bit)
Server3|poweredOn|268401|[Z0109-XXX-PFCHT2-VMS-R001SM] Not SR or SFCHT1/Server1.vmx|Solaris 3.2

$ sed -e '/[[][^]]*SFCHT1[]-]/s/poweredOn/poweredOn|T1/' \
      -e '/[[][^]]*SR[]-]/s/poweredOn/poweredOn|DR/' file.csv
Server1|poweredOn|DR|T1|268401|[Z0109-GEN-SFCHT1-VMS-R001SR] Server1/Server1.vmx|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5 (64-bit)
Server2|poweredOn|T1|268401|[Z0110-DSP-SFCHT1-VMS-R001SM] Not SR/Server1.vmx|Red Hat Enterprise Linux 3.2 (32-bit)
Server3|poweredOn|268401|[Z0109-XXX-PFCHT2-VMS-R001SM] Not SR or SFCHT1/Server1.vmx|Solaris 3.2

NAME
obus-gen-client - generate client-side ocaml bindings from D-Bus introspection files SYNOPSIS
obus-gen-client [ options ] input-file DESCRIPTION
obus-gen-client generates an ocaml module from D-Bus introspection files. The generated module contains functions to send method calls, receive signals and read/write properties. It depends on the interface module generated with obus-gen-interface. The module generated by obus-gen-client it is meant to be edited. OPTIONS
-o output-prefix Use this name as output prefix. It defaults to the input file name without its extension and extended with "_client". For example, if the input file name is "foo.xml" (or "foo.obus"), then "obus-gen-client" will generate "foo_client.ml" and "foo_client.mli". -keep-common Keeps common interfaces, i.e. all interfaces starting with "org.freedesktop.DBus". By default they are dropped. -help or --help Display a short usage summary and exit. AUTHOR
Jeremie Dimino <jeremie@dimino.org> SEE ALSO
obus-introspect(1), obus-gen-interface(1), obus-gen-server(1). April 2010 OBUS-GEN-CLIENT(1)
